vtr box in vts

  1. #1
    Are there any major changes I need to do to fit a vtr gearbox into a vts? Or is it literally take vts box out, fit vtr box in.

    No changes to driveshafts required either.

    I need a new gearbox and have a vtr box to hand, just want to check before I go ahead and fit it.

    Thanks.
  2. #2
    iirc theres not difference, but dont quote me on it
  3. #3
    will slip straight on no other changes nescessary
  4. #4
    yep, nothing needs changing
  5. #5
    Straight swap but you know the vtr box has longet ratios so it will be a slightly slower acceleration? Better fuel though.
